Communal Laundry Solutions with EC3 Laundry Additive

Living in an apartment building or shared housing often comes with great perks – convenience, location, and sometimes, even a sense of community. However, shared spaces like laundry facilities can also present unique challenges. One such challenge is maintaining a clean and healthy environment, especially when it comes to preventing mold growth.

Mold spores can thrive in damp environments, and laundry rooms with frequent washing machine use are prime targets. These microscopic spores can then latch onto clothes, towels, and linens, potentially leading to unpleasant odors, allergy triggers, and even health problems.

Using EC3 Laundry Additive in Shared Laundry: Simple and Effective

Using EC3 Laundry Additive in a shared laundry facility is easy and convenient. Here’s a quick guide:

  • For HE Washers: For high-efficiency washing machines, simply add one ounce of EC3 Laundry Additive to the rinse cycle reservoir, typically where you’d add fabric softener, during your regular wash cycle.
  • For Other Washers: If you’re using a non-HE washer, add two ounces of EC3 Laundry Additive to the rinse cycle reservoir in the same manner.
  • Cleaning the Washing Machine: For a deep clean of your shared washing machine, add three ounces of EC3 Laundry Additive to the bleach well or directly into the machine and run the “clean” cycle, if available.
